When I put my Versa 4 on the charger, the screen keeps switching from the home screen to the charging screen every 5 seconds and isn't actually charging.
I'm using the charger it came with, and the pins are all aligned etc.
Any ideas? I only bought it 3 days ago!
Thank you

As per the description of your post, it could be a sign the contacts need cleaning. Dust and debris can accumulate over time. Clean the charging contacts on the back of your device and the pins on your charging cable using the instructions in How do I clean my Fitbit device?
Please find below some tips to best charge Fitbit devices:
- Use only genuine Fitbit charging cables
- Use only UL-certified wall chargers
- Avoid USB battery packs
- Charge at room temperature
For charging purposes, your charging cable or your base station can be plugged into any USB power source, including but not limited to:
- A computer
- A Wall A/C to USB adapter, commonly found with smartphones
- A DC to USB adapter (vehicle power port)

I've only had the fitbit since Friday 6th September, so dust can't have built up over time.
I've still checked and cleaned the pins and contacts and it's still doing the same thing.
I think there's something wrong with the battery as each time I try to charge it it's saying a different percentage.
When I first opened it on Friday it was at 53%, yesterday when I charged it it was at 24%, then dropped to 7% in 5 minutes, and today when I've tried again it's at 45%!
Any further advice is welcome.
